ar0ck 02-24-2009 11:53 PM

If your car is lowered I highly recommend that you get the fenders rolled in the rear or you'll eat through the tires like nobody's business.

EchoMirage 02-25-2009 08:10 AM

pontiacs have wider wheel wells then camaros. i rolled my rears, but even without, i didnt rub at all. on TAs, you may have to beat the inside of the well, not the outside. especially since most rims have the camaro offset, not the pontiac one.
